Environmental Insights Comparison: San diego vs Plantation

  • Water quality is rated higher in San diego at 7/10 compared to 6/10 in Plantation.
  • Median air quality indexes are identical in both cities at 2.0.
  • The average air quality index is worse in San diego with 2.24 compared to 1.65 in Plantation.
  • More days with poor air quality are reported in San diego at 109 compared to 40 in Plantation.
